homemade non power steering?????

is better to leave the rack open to breath? or do i loop it with fluid inside?

if i do loop it fill it up?

or have air in there?

I just bought a manual rack from AJE. It comes with everything to bolt it in, including bump steer kit, steering shaft, and Pinto rack. It was $595. Very good quality.

I assume you dont plan on ever using it again correct? evacuate the rack and just cap it. Its easier to move it with no fluid at all then full and looped...

I did it that way but my car doesnt see street use anymore.
